but for blowing up sprites I'd do it in a graphics program...You'll want to be careful about how you increase the image size. if you are working in photoshop make sure you choose the option "nearest neighbor" for resample image when changing the size.
also youll probably want to increase the size in multiples of 4 (or double the width, double the height), so that each square pixel can become a 2x2 square pixel, or a 4x4 square pixel...otherwise the pattern will look weird.
